Internet Algorithmics

Internet Algorithmics pdf epub mobi txt 电子书 下载 2026

出版者:Pearson Education
作者:George Varghese
出品人:
页数:400
译者:
出版时间:2004-08-20
价格:USD 44.99
装帧:Paperback
isbn号码:9780201379549
丛书系列:
图书标签:
  • 算法
  • 互联网
  • 数据结构
  • 网络算法
  • 分布式系统
  • 性能优化
  • Web算法
  • 云计算
  • 大数据
  • 计算机科学
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

好的,这是一份关于一本名为《互联网算法学》(Internet Algorithmics)的图书的详细简介,其内容旨在涵盖该领域的重要方面,但不会涉及您提到的具体书名内容。 --- 图书名称: 算法与现实:连接数字世界的底层逻辑 内容简介 在信息爆炸的时代,我们与数字世界的交互日益频繁,从搜索引擎的即时反馈到社交媒体的信息流推送,再到复杂供应链的优化管理,背后都依赖于一套精妙的算法体系。本书《算法与现实:连接数字世界的底层逻辑》旨在深入剖析那些驱动现代互联网、大数据分析和人工智能系统的核心计算原理与实际应用。我们不仅关注算法的理论基础,更着重探讨它们如何在现实世界的约束下被构建、优化和部署。 本书结构严谨,内容涵盖了从基础的图论、数据结构到高级的机器学习算法、分布式计算模型。它将引导读者跨越理论的象牙塔,直面工程实践中的挑战,理解算法设计者在效率、准确性和资源消耗之间所做的权衡。 第一部分:计算基石与网络结构 本部分从基础出发,为后续的深入探讨奠定坚实的基础。我们首先回顾了经典算法分析中的关键概念,如时间复杂度和空间复杂度,并引入了现代计算环境中至关重要的摊还分析(Amortized Analysis)方法,这对于理解流式处理和动态数据结构至关重要。 随后,我们将焦点转向支撑互联网基础设施的图论。现代网络拓扑、路由协议乃至社交网络的结构,本质上都可以用图来建模。本书详细介绍了经典的图搜索算法(BFS, DFS),以及在大型网络中寻找最短路径(Dijkstra, A)和最小生成树(Prim, Kruskal)的实际策略。更进一步,我们探讨了网络流问题及其在资源分配和流量控制中的应用,例如如何利用最大流/最小割定理来设计高效的负载均衡机制。 第二部分:数据管理与高效检索 互联网的本质是海量数据的存储与检索。本部分深入研究了用于处理大规模数据集的高效数据结构与索引技术。 我们详细阐述了哈希表在构建高性能查找系统中的作用,并讨论了处理哈希冲突和实现一致性哈希(Consistent Hashing)的策略,后者是构建可扩展、无状态分布式系统的关键。对于需要保持顺序和范围查询的数据,本书对比了B树及其变种(如B+树)在数据库系统中的应用,以及如何利用跳跃表(Skip Lists)实现高效的动态集合管理。 针对搜索引擎和推荐系统的需求,本书花费大量篇幅讲解了文本索引技术。我们剖析了倒排索引的构建过程,并讨论了如何利用前缀树(Trie)和后缀数组(Suffix Arrays)实现快速的字符串匹配和模糊查询。此外,我们还探讨了文档相似度计算的经典方法,如TF-IDF模型及其局限性,为后续的语义分析打下基础。 第三部分:决策、排序与推荐系统 在用户生成内容和个性化服务的驱动下,如何有效地组织信息流、做出准确预测成为核心挑战。本部分聚焦于排序算法和初级机器学习模型在实际系统中的部署。 我们探讨了比较排序算法的理论极限,并转向实用性更强的选择算法(如快速选择)在海量数据中寻找中值或Top-K元素的应用。在推荐系统方面,本书介绍了协同过滤(Collaborative Filtering)的基础原理,包括基于用户的和基于物品的推荐策略。我们分析了矩阵分解技术(如SVD)如何用于降低数据稀疏性带来的挑战,并讨论了如何将这些模型集成到实时系统中,以提供低延迟的个性化结果。 第四部分:分布式计算与系统规模化 现代互联网应用无法脱离分布式环境而存在。本部分关注如何在多台机器上协同工作以处理超出单机能力范围的任务。 我们深入研究了MapReduce范式,分析其在处理大规模批处理任务中的优势与局限性。在此基础上,本书介绍了流式计算(Stream Processing)的概念,对比了如Spark Streaming或Flink等框架背后的核心思想,强调了窗口操作(Windowing)和状态管理的重要性。 一致性与容错性是分布式系统的生命线。本书详细介绍了共识算法(Consensus Algorithms),如Paxos和Raft,解释了它们如何确保系统在部分节点失效时仍能保持数据一致性。此外,我们还讨论了分布式事务处理中的两阶段提交(2PC)以及如何权衡一致性、可用性和分区容错性(CAP定理)。 第五部分:性能优化与工程实践 算法的价值最终体现在其实际性能上。本部分侧重于将理论转化为高效、健壮的工程实现。 我们探讨了缓存机制的设计哲学,从L1/L2硬件缓存到应用层和CDN缓存策略。本书分析了缓存失效策略(如LRU, LFU)的优劣,并讨论了如何利用缓存预热和一致性协议来优化用户体验。 在算法部署层面,本书讨论了近似算法(Approximation Algorithms)和随机化算法(Randomized Algorithms)在需要极高吞吐量和可接受误差的场景中的价值,例如使用布隆过滤器(Bloom Filters)进行高效的成员查询,或使用HyperLogLog估算大规模集合的基数。我们还介绍了Profiling工具和性能分析技术,指导读者识别算法中的性能瓶颈并进行针对性的优化。 结论 《算法与现实:连接数字世界的底层逻辑》旨在为系统工程师、数据科学家和计算机科学专业学生提供一个全面、实用的视角,去理解和掌握驱动当今数字世界运行的核心计算智慧。通过理论与工程实践的结合,本书力求培养读者在面对复杂系统挑战时,能够设计出既优雅又高效的解决方案。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

我最近刚拿到这本《Internet Algorithmics》,光是拿到手,就能感受到它非同寻常的分量。不是指它的实际重量,而是指它所承载的那种厚重感和深度。从书本的整体风格来看,它似乎并非是那种轻松愉快的读物,而是更偏向于学术探讨或是专业领域的深度挖掘。书页的排版整齐而严谨,文字的间距和行高都经过精心设计,确保了阅读的流畅性,即使是密集的专业术语,也能让人在理解的道路上少一些障碍。我注意到书中可能涉及到大量图表和公式,这对于需要精确理解概念的读者来说至关重要。它的封面设计也暗示着一种系统性、逻辑性的知识体系,就像一张精密绘制的地图,指引着我们穿越复杂的信息网络。我个人非常看重书籍的结构和逻辑清晰度,而《Internet Algorithmics》的这种严谨风格,让我对其内容质量充满了信心。

评分

说实话,当我看到《Internet Algorithmics》这本书的时候,最先打动我的并非是它名字本身,而是它那种独特的气质。它不像市面上那些充斥着夸张标题和浮夸宣传的畅销书,而是散发出一种沉静而内敛的智慧光芒。封面设计简洁却不失品味,没有过多的装饰,但却能引人深思。我猜测这本书的内容会是那种需要耐心和专注去品味的,它可能不是那种能够让你在短时间内获得“速成”知识的书籍,而是更倾向于构建一种扎实的、系统性的理解。它或许会带我们深入到互联网运作的核心,去理解那些支撑起庞大信息世界的底层逻辑。这种类型的书籍,往往能够给予读者更长久的影响,因为它不仅仅是传递信息,更是激发思考,培养一种解决问题的能力。我期待它能像一位循循善诱的导师,引导我一步步揭开互联网算法的神秘面纱。

评分

我喜欢《Internet Algorithmics》这本书的整体氛围。它散发着一种严谨、求实的学术气息,同时又透露着一丝探索未知的好奇心。封面上的设计,不论是色彩的选择还是图形的运用,都显得十分用心,仿佛精心雕琢过的艺术品。它没有华丽的辞藻,也没有煽情的口号,但却能在一瞬间抓住我的注意力。我感觉到这本书会是一场智力上的冒险,它不会轻易地揭示所有答案,而是鼓励读者主动去思考、去探究。它可能就像一扇通往新世界的大门,需要我们用智慧去解锁。对于那些渴望深入理解事物本质、追求知识深度的人来说,《Internet Algorithmics》无疑会是一个绝佳的选择。我期待它能提供一种全新的视角,帮助我重新认识这个我每天都在使用的互联网世界。

评分

《Internet Algorithmics》这本书的封面设计给我一种扑面而来的现代感和科技感。亮丽的色彩搭配,以及其中蕴含的几何图形元素,都让我联想到数据可视化和复杂的网络结构。它没有采用传统的书籍封面设计,而是大胆地运用了具有冲击力的视觉语言,这本身就传递出一种创新和突破的信号。我猜想这本书的内容也会同样具有前瞻性和创新性,可能涉及到一些最新的研究成果或是前沿的算法应用。对于我这样对互联网技术发展保持高度关注的人来说,这样的书籍无疑是极具吸引力的。它似乎在宣告,这本书将带我们进入一个充满活力和变革的世界,去探索那些正在塑造我们未来的技术力量。我对书中可能呈现的那些新颖的视角和独特的见解充满了期待,希望它能带给我一些意想不到的启发。

评分

这本书的封面设计简直是一场视觉盛宴!深邃的蓝色背景,仿佛浩瀚的宇宙,上面点缀着闪烁的星辰,中间则是一个抽象而又极具力量感的银色算法图形,线条流畅,交织错落,透露出一种神秘而又精确的美感。我第一眼就被它吸引住了,立刻联想到那些隐藏在数据洪流中的规律和秩序,以及人工智能背后那令人惊叹的智慧。书的纸张质量也非常出色,触感温润而厚实,翻阅时不会有廉价感,装订牢固,即使经常翻阅也不易散页。书的尺寸也很合适,既不会太大占地方,也不会太小显得不够分量,放在书架上,它绝对是一道亮丽的风景线,让人忍不住想要伸手去触摸,去探寻它所蕴含的知识。我特别喜欢它封面传递出的那种沉静、思考的氛围,仿佛在邀请读者一同潜入算法的海洋,进行一场深入的探索。这种高品质的包装,无疑为阅读体验奠定了良好的基础,让我对书中的内容充满了期待,迫不及待地想翻开第一页,让思绪随着那些精妙的算法一同飞舞。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有